Faithless 2000

Written by Ingmar Bergman, this personal drama depicts actress Marianne and musician Markus whose intense affair shatters their marriage. Marianne moves in with her lover, while Markus denies her custody of their daughter. He later offers a risky solution that plunges them into deception, betrayal and ultimately tragedy.

Full Plot Summary and Ending Explained for Faithless

An aging director, [Bergman], conjures in his imagination the central character, Marianne. He interviews [Marianne] to compose the story of her life-changing affair. Marianne had been happily married to [Markus], an orchestra conductor, with a young daughter [Isabelle]. Her best friend is [David], who is seeking funding for a film project. When Markus is away, David approaches Marianne and they go to Marianne’s home. There, David surprises her by asking her if they can sleep together. Marianne asserts she sees David more as a brother; she eventually agrees they can sleep in the same bed in nightwear and without sexual relations. However, the two note they are both planning to be in Paris, France, for separate projects. Markus is aware of their travel plans, and Marianne speculates she and David can meet in Paris, and they would not have to deceive Markus about seeing each other there.

In Paris, Marianne and David begin their affair. David also asks Marianne about her sexual history, and Marianne shares her list of experiences; but this mostly consists of her relations with Marcus, who she said had satisfied her in ways no one else had. This triggers a violent jealous reaction in David.

David and Marianne continue their affair after returning from Paris. Markus realises they are having an affair and eventually discovers the two together. Markus begins to seek a divorce, and seeks full custody of Isabelle. Marianne gets a lawyer, who tells her Markus has the upper hand, given her desertion of the home. Marianne moves in with David and the two plan to get married; Marianne becomes pregnant with his child. Her lawyer advises that these improved conditions could help her custody case.

Markus eventually reaches out to Marianne to meet him alone to settle the custody case, ostensibly for Isabelle’s sake. Despite David’s angry objections, she agrees to go. At the meeting, Markus blackmails her for sex in exchange for custody.

Marianne confesses to the affair to David. The two separate and Marianne has an abortion. After hearing Markus has committed suicide, Marianne learns he had also been unfaithful with his page-turner. Bergman bids farewell to Marianne, but she says she suspects they will meet again.
